Your first tai chi class at Three Treasures Martial Arts
Nervous about walking into a tai chi class for the first time? Almost everyone is, and good instructors expect beginners to come through the door. Here's what to know. What to expect: a typical first class is a gentle warm-up, then learning a few slow movements of the form, step by step — no pressure to get it perfect, and you can rest or sit whenever you need to. What to wear: loose, comfortable clothing you can move in, and flat, flexible shoes (some studios practice in socks or bare feet). What to bring: water, and that's about it — there's no equipment to buy. Arrive a few minutes early to say hello to the instructor and mention it's your first class. It comes together faster than you'd think — most people feel far more at ease by their second or third visit.
